Desmin and CD34 positivity in cellular fibrous histiocytoma: an immunohistochemical analysis of 100 cases.
Journal of Cutaneous Pathology, 06/26/2012
Volpicelli ER et al. – Frequent desmin (32%) and occasional CD34 (6%) expression are encountered in Cellular benign fibrous histiocytoma (CBFH). Desmin positivity can be explained on the basis of myofibroblastic differentiation. The occasional CD34 positivity in a subset of CBFH should not be a deterrent from making the correct pathologic diagnosis, based on characteristic morphologic features.
